Council approves $1.97 million budget amendment for dispatch pay, records software and bond redemption

Summary

Council approved a $1,973,416.45 amendment to the 2025–26 budget to implement a dispatch pay program, purchase new public‑information‑request software, and add funds to the bond redemption program and future CIP projects; staff noted recurring costs in future budgets.

Victoria City Council on Jan. 6 approved a budget amendment totaling $1,973,416.45 to cover several municipal priorities, city staff said.
